A few months ago I made a pipe that I thought would suit a simple Hobbit farmer. Well, that pipe made it's way back to me and I decided that I needed to make a cabinet as a place to store it along with a long stem pipe my daughters gave me for Christmas years ago. I borrowed some Greene and Greene design elements, such as the cloud lift, as I feel that has a "Hobbit" feel and I wanted it to look like it could be at home in Bag End. I wonder if Tolkien would agree.
Pipe Build - • A "Hobbit Farmer" Pipe...
The wood for this project came from a board that I salvaged at a demolition site. I'm amazed at the quality of lumber that was used in construction nearly 100 years ago. Today it would be very expensive CVG Douglas Fir.

I particularly liked the square dowels I will be using this technique. What was the little tool you used to square up the dowle hole? Cheers Karl
@StanCrafted
@StanCrafted 4 жыл бұрын
@@karlpopewoodcraft You are spot on with the accuracy up front leads to quality builds down the line comment. When doing square plugs that are less than a quarter of an inch I've had success just using square steel stock to make the opening. I grind the end a little bit to get it started easier and then just tap it in. For this cabinet the plugs and the steel were 3/16 of an inch.
